Print guide

Open the PDF

Click the Download PDF button to open the print-ready file in a new browser tab before printing or saving.

Print at 100% scale

Use the browser print dialog at full size so the line art stays crisp and the page margin remains intact.

Pick paper that matches your coloring tools

Standard 80gsm paper works for everyday use. Move to heavier paper if you plan to color with markers.

Coloring ideas

  • Use one main color for the gown and a second accent color for the bows to keep the outfit coordinated.
  • Try warm pinks, peaches, or lavenders for the flowers to make the bouquet stand out at the center.
  • Add gentle shading along the waves of the hair and folds of the skirt for extra depth.
  • Color the crown in gold or silver tones and use bright jewel colors for the center details.
